返回顶部
首页 > 资讯 > 数据库 >Sqoop ETL工具的基本操作
  • 742
分享到

Sqoop ETL工具的基本操作

2024-04-02 19:04:59 742人浏览 独家记忆
摘要

Sqoop ETL工具的基本操作查看 sqoop 命令说明sqoop help查看某一个命令的使用说明:sqoop cammond -help从orange,Mysql到hdfssqoop import -

Sqoop ETL工具的基本操作

查看 sqoop 命令说明

sqoop help


查看某一个命令的使用说明:

sqoop cammond -help


从orange,Mysqlhdfs

sqoop import --connect jdbc:oracle:thin:@192.168.1.254:1521:orcl --username bd_user   --passWord bd_user   --table GS_B_GY_DWCPNYXHBJG_S  —target-dir '/user/haha/' -m 1




sqoop import --connect jdbc:mysql://192.168.1.232:3307/bigdatamanager --username root --password root --table gbi_pd_log —target-dir /user/hehe -m 1





从oracle,mysqlHive

sqoop import-all-tables --connect jdbc:oracle:thin:@192.168.1.232:14231:xe --username bhl_user --password bhl_user --hive-database bhl_user -m 1 --create-hive-table --hive-import —hive-overwrite

 sqoop import --connect jdbc:oracle:thin:@192.168.1.232:14231:xe --username bhl_user  --password bhl_user —table BD_ECO_TX_2015_0516

sqoop import --connect jdbc:oracle:thin:@192.168.1.232:14231:xe --username bhl_user  --password bhl_user --table BD_ECO_TX_2015_0516 —hive-import —hive-database bhl_user -m 1(oracle 连接的截图在这就不写了,下面是mysql的测试)

======================================================================

列出数据库

sqoop list-databases --connect jdbc:mysql://192.168.1.232:3307/bigdatamanager --username root --password root


列出bigdatamanager数据库中的表

sqoop list-tables --connect jdbc:mysql://192.168.1.232:3307/bigdatamanager --username root --password root


从mysql到hive

 sqoop import --connect jdbc:mysql://192.168.1.232:3307/bigdatamanager --username root —password root —table insurance_yearcost -hive-import





 

 

 

 

   


您可能感兴趣的文档:

--结束END--

本文标题: Sqoop ETL工具的基本操作

本文链接: https://lsjlt.com/news/37833.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

猜你喜欢
  • Sqoop ETL工具的基本操作
    Sqoop ETL工具的基本操作查看 sqoop 命令说明sqoop help查看某一个命令的使用说明:sqoop cammond -help从orange,mysql到hdfssqoop import -...
    99+
    2024-04-02
  • Sqoop与传统ETL工具有什么区别
    Sqoop与传统ETL工具的主要区别在于其适用的场景和用途: Sqoop是专门用于将数据从关系型数据库导入到Hadoop集群中的工...
    99+
    2024-04-02
  • LOB的基本操作和工作
    LOB(即大型对象)是数据库管理系统 (DBMS) 中的一种数据类型,用于存储大量非结构化数据,例如文本、图像和视频。 LOB 数据类型对于存储和操作不适合传统行列结构的数据非常有用,例如文档、图形或音频文件。 在本文中,我们将探讨DBMS...
    99+
    2023-10-22
  • Python数据清洗工具之Numpy的基本操作
    目录1. Numpy(Numberical Python)1.1 这库的安装方法2.Numpy的基础操作2.1 数组的创建:np.arrary()2.2 N维数组的创建2.3 常用数...
    99+
    2024-04-02
  • PHP与ETL工具的集成
    随着企业数据变得越来越庞大和复杂,数据处理和分析的需求变得愈发迫切。为了解决这一问题,ETL(抽取、转换、加载)工具逐渐成为了企业数据处理和分析的重要工具。PHP作为一门流行的Web开发语言,也可以通过与ETL工具的集成来提高数据处理和分析...
    99+
    2023-05-16
    集成 PHP ETL工具
  • JBPM工作流基本操作
    JBPM(Java Business Process Model)是一个用于创建、执行和管理工作流的开源框架。下面是一些JBPM工作...
    99+
    2023-09-21
    JBPM
  • ETL工具sed进阶是怎么样的
    ETL工具sed进阶是怎么样的,很多新手对此不是很清楚,为了帮助大家解决这个难题,下面小编将为大家详细讲解,有这方面需求的人可以来学习下,希望你能有所收获。sed 详解我觉得 sed 玩到最后,应该触及的最高难度的问题,有这些:替换百万行文...
    99+
    2023-06-06
  • ETL工具 - Kettle 查询、连接、统计、脚本算子介绍
    一、 Kettle 上篇文章对 Kettle 流程、应用算子进行了介绍,本篇对查询、连接、统计、脚本算子进行讲解,下面是上篇文章的地址: ETL工具 - Kettle 流程、应用算子介绍 二、查...
    99+
    2023-09-03
    etl mysql kettle
  • Oracle的基本操作
    一、启动和关闭数据库1. 如何启动数据库sqlplus / as sysdba      ---登录数据库SQL> startup      ...
    99+
    2024-04-02
  • mysql的基本操作
    一、库操作 创建库:create database 数据库的名字; 删除库:drop database 数据库的名字; 查看当前有多少个数据库:show databases; 查看当前使用的数据库:select databas...
    99+
    2023-01-31
    操作 mysql
  • Python操作SQLLite(基本操作
      SQLite 是一个软件库,实现了自给自足的、无服务器的、零配置的、事务性的 SQL 数据库引擎。SQLite 是在世界上最广泛部署的 SQL 数据库引擎。SQLite 源代码不受版权限制。 Python SQLITE数据库是一款非常...
    99+
    2023-01-31
    操作 Python SQLLite
  • 基于C#实现一个简单的FTP操作工具
    目录实现功能开发环境实现代码实现效果实现功能 实现使用FTP上传、下载、重命名、刷新、删除功能 开发环境 开发工具: Visual Studio 2013 .NET Framewor...
    99+
    2024-04-02
  • Mysql基本操作
    二、删除已经有的数据库school 三、创建新数据库myschool 四、进入到myschool中 ...
    99+
    2019-11-20
    Mysql基本操作
  • Hive基本操作
    01.Hive是什么1. Hive介绍Hive是基于Hadoop的一个数据仓库工具,可以将结构化的数据文件映射为一张数据库表,并提供类SQL查询功能。Hive是SQL解析引擎,它将SQL语句转译成M/R J...
    99+
    2024-04-02
  • oracle基本操作
    对表的结构操作                        add   &...
    99+
    2024-04-02
  • PostgreSQL基本操作
    1.创建用户postgres=# create user test password 'test';CREATE ROLE注意:在PostgreSQL 里没有区分用户和角色的概念,"CREATE ...
    99+
    2024-04-02
  • ORCALE基本操作
    创建表空间CREATE SMALLFILE TABLESPACE TTKDTEST datafile '/opt/oracle/oradatas/otwb/dbf.DMP' SIZE 100M REUSE ...
    99+
    2024-04-02
  • [MongoDB] 基本操作
    ...
    99+
    2024-04-02
  • mongoDB基本操作
    MongdoDB实例—》数据库—》集合—》文档—》字段(key/value pair)bin 执行./mongod     启动  &后台启动./m...
    99+
    2024-04-02
  • SQLServer基本操作
    SQLServer基本操作数据库的创建1、打开“SSMS”工具,连接到SQLServer。右击“数据库”-“新建数据库”2、指定新建的数据库名称、所有者。(新建数据库时系统自动创建一个主要数据文件和一个事务...
    99+
    2024-04-02
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作